Output 31408155b38cb881039bc3da94566dbf72970739d0c74ae0894f4c2a1e2615dc:1

value
12730723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5137ffc0267ad6a27efb3f7d4a7c4ecaf5fb117 OP_EQUAL
address
3NaG2MPsH3thJQpZYm4jupqJkHgNY1Ki3t
transaction
31408155b38cb881039bc3da94566dbf72970739d0c74ae0894f4c2a1e2615dc
confirmations
332796
spent
true